Super Micro Computer (SMCI) has announced the appointment of Matthew Thauberger as its new Chief Revenue Officer. This executive move signals the company’s focus on strengthening its revenue generation and market expansion strategies, potentially impacting its competitive position in the server and AI infrastructure market.

Super Micro Computer, a leading provider of high-performance server and storage solutions, recently disclosed the appointment of Matthew Thauberger to the role of Chief Revenue Officer. The appointment comes as the company continues to navigate a rapidly evolving technology landscape, particularly in the artificial intelligence and data center sectors. Thauberger’s background and experience are expected to play a key role in driving SMCI’s revenue growth initiatives. While the company did not provide specific details on his previous roles or compensation, such executive appointments often align with strategic efforts to enhance sales leadership, optimize customer relationships, and expand into new markets. Super Micro Computer has been actively scaling its operations to meet rising demand for AI-optimized hardware, a segment where revenue generation has become increasingly competitive. The news was reported by Yahoo Finance and reflects SMCI’s ongoing corporate development activities. The appointment may also be part of a broader organizational restructuring to improve operational efficiency and market responsiveness.

Key takeaways from this appointment include a potential reinforcement of SMCI’s sales and go-to-market strategy. As Chief Revenue Officer, Thauberger would likely oversee global sales, channel partnerships, and customer success efforts. This could help Super Micro Computer better capitalize on the growing demand for accelerated computing and liquid-cooled solutions, areas where the company has been investing heavily. Market observers suggest that leadership changes in revenue-focused roles often precede shifts in pricing strategies, sales territories, or product bundling approaches. For SMCI, which faces intense competition from larger rivals such as Dell Technologies and Hewlett Packard Enterprise, strengthening its revenue engine may be critical to maintaining market share. The appointment also underscores the importance of executive talent in driving top-line growth, especially as the AI infrastructure build-out continues to accelerate across industries.
